What is 5d - 10 = 20​

Answers

Here is your equation:

5d-10=20

In this equation, you're looking for the value of d alone. That means you would have to move everything next to the variable to the other side. You can do that by doing the opposite of what's being done to it.

In this equation, 5d is being subtracted by 10(-10). The opposite of that is adding 10(+10). You would have to add 10 to both sides, since -10 and +10 cancel out each other.

The first thing you are going to do is add 10 to both sides.

5d-10+10=20+10 \n 5d = 30

Now you're left with the equation 5d=30. Remember that you're looking for d alone. In the current equation, d is being multiplied by 5(5d ⇒ 5 × d). Again, you're going to do the opposite of what's being done to it. The opposite of multiplying is dividing, therefore, you're going to divide both sides by 5, since the 5 divided by 5 is 1, which cancels out the 5.

Divide both sides by 5.

(5d)/(5) =(30)/(5) \n \nd=6

That means the answer to your equation is d = 6.

A cracker company wants to make a rectangular box to hold their crackers. They want the height of the box to be 10 inches and the width to be 4 inches. Explain how to calculate the length the box needs to be in order for the volume of the box to be 200 cubic inches.

Answers

since v=l×w×h and you are given v=200, w=4, and h=10, you can solve for l by making the equation l=v/hw.  That means that l=200/40=5.  That means that the length needs to be 5 inches long.

Answer and step-by-step explanation:

The box must be 5 inches long.

The formula for the volume of a rectangular prism (a box) is

V = length*width*height

The volume of 200, the height is 10 and the width is 4.  This gives us

200 = length*10(4)

Letting x be the length,

200 = x(10)(4)

200 = 40x

Divide both sides by 40:

200/40 = 40x/40

5 = x
